Comparing the effects of low-load resistance training with and without BFR in shoulder impingement syndrome

To compare the effects of low-load resistance training with and without blood flow restriction on thickness, strength and pain of shoulder girdle muscles in individuals with shoulder impingement syndrome

Inclusion criteria

Inclusion criteria: Age between 40 to 60 years Literacy in Persian experiencing shoulder pain for a maximum of 3 months Shoulder pain at night or during overhead activities greater than or equal to 3 based on VAS scale Positive Painful arc test and at least three of the following tests: Neer- Hawkins-kennedy- Empty can- infraspinatus

Exclusion criteria

Exclusion criteria: Contraindications for the use of BFR, including:• History of blood clots (DVT)• Blood pressure higher than 180 mmHg• Acute infection, peripheral vascular problems, varicose veins, or cancer.• History of hemorrhagic or thrombotic strokes.• History of arterial fibrillation Simultaneous pain in both shoulders Suffering from frozen shoulder Positive drop arm test indicating a complete rotator cuff tear History of surgery, fracture, or dislocation in the shoulder area Use of anti-inflammatory drugs during the day while undergoing the physiotherapy course

Design outcomes

Primary

MeasureTime frame
Isometric muscle strength of the rotator cuff muscles (supraspinatus). Timepoint: pre and post intervention. Method of measurement: hand-held, fixed dynamometer.

Secondary

MeasureTime frame
Thickness of supraspinatus, infraspinatus, middle trapezius, and biceps muscles at rest. Timepoint: pre and post intervention. Method of measurement: B-mode ultrasonography (model: Supersonic MACH30).;Night pain and pain while elevating the shoulder. Timepoint: pre and post intervention. Method of measurement: Numeric pain rating scale.;Pain pressure threshold on 2 points (end of supraspinatus muscle and thenar area of ??the affected side). Timepoint: pre and post intervention. Method of measurement: digital algometer.;Functional pain and disability. Timepoint: pre and post intervention. Method of measurement: Shoulder Pain and Disability Index questionnaire.
